This checklist provides a general idea of the documents and information that will be necessary for a due diligence investigation when purchasing a broadcast station.

Owning a radio station can be profitable, but success largely depends on effective management and market conditions. The revenue typically comes from advertising sales, sponsorships, and possibly event hosting. Engaging content and community involvement can also boost listenership and profitability. To obtain a license for broadcasting, a station must submit an application to the FCC that includes technical information, proposed programming, and financial details. The application is then reviewed, and if approved, the station will receive its broadcasting license. Broadcast licenses grant permission to operate a radio station and transmit signals to the public. These licenses are typically valid for a specific term, after which they must be renewed.
